Diagnosing The Problem


First and foremost, it is important to diagnose the problem accurately before attempting any repairs. This will help you avoid unnecessary expenses and ensure that you are targeting the root cause of the issue. Common washer problems include leaks, excessive noise, failure to start or complete cycles, and drum not spinning. By identifying the specific problem, you can save both time and money.


Check for Clogs


One budget-friendly tip for washer repair is to check for clogs. Clogs in the hoses or drainage system can cause water to leak or prevent proper draining, resulting in inefficient washing. Inspect the hoses for any blockages and remove them if necessary. Additionally, clean the lint trap regularly to prevent clogs and improve the overall performance of your washer.


Replacing Parts


Another cost-effective tip is to replace worn-out parts instead of buying a new washer. Many times, a malfunctioning washer can be repaired just by replacing a single component. Common parts that may need replacement include belts, motor brushes, or door seals. By purchasing these parts online or from a local appliance store, you can save a significant amount of money compared to buying a brand-new washer.


Regular Maintenance


Proper maintenance is key to extending the lifespan of your washer and preventing expensive repairs. Regularly clean the detergent dispenser, as residue buildup can lead to clogs and affect the performance of your washer. Additionally, avoid overloading the machine as this can strain the motor and other components. By following the manufacturer's instructions for maintenance and usage, you can minimize the need for costly repairs.
